Chocolate cherry muffins

G made these for her snack this week (I love muffins because they keep so much better than cakes and I was hoping that the chocolate may appeal to Miss I but she rejected them as they had dried cherries in them - oh well!)

  • 250g self-raising flour
  • 1 tsp bicarbonate of soda
  • 140g dried sour cherries
  • 100g bar white chocolate , cut into chunks
  • 100g bar dark chocolate , cut into chunks
  • 100g golden caster sugar
  • 2 eggs
  • 150ml pot natural yoghurt
  • 100g butter 

  1. Heat oven to (fan) 180C and put paper cases into a muffin tin
  2. Sift the flour, and bicarbonate of soda into a large bowl. Then stir in the cherries, chocolate and sugar. 
  3. Melt the butter (we did it in the microwave)
  4. Add the beaten eggs, yoghurt and then the butter and stir to combine. Apparently it doesn't matter if the mixture looks a bit lumpy, it's more important not to over mix or the muffins will turn out tough.
  5. Fill the paper cases and bake for 20-25 mins until risen and golden brown. Transfer to a rack to cool.
